J Lemus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by O'Hair-Wards Funeral Chapel on Feb. 2, 2026.
Jesus died peacefully surrounded by family at the age of 92 on January 3rd 2026 in Malin, Oregon.

Jesus was born May 27th 1933 in La Quemada, a small town in rural Mexico in the state of Michoacan. He was the fifth child out of twelve born to Refugio Lemus and Rufina Alvarez.

From a young age he contributed to the family chores raising cattle, goats and pigs and farming. Formal education was minimal and much of his learning was on his own. This trait would serve him well later in his adult life when he found himself in a foreign land needing to learn a new language.

In 1965 he married and soon had a growing family. Like many of his generation, he looked to the United States for employment, initially migrating back and forth following seasonal work. He eventually settled the family in southern Oregon/northern California (Tulelake, Malin, Bonanza).

He loved God, his family and the United States. He lived a life of challenges and obstacles and met each with resilience and perseverance. He contributed to the church and made miracles with his earnings by the way of self discipline and restrain. He was generous and needed very little to be happy.

In his mid 70s he developed dementia and in his 80s suffered a brain stroke, eventually leaving him in a wheelchair. Throughout these health issues, his humor was playful and light-hearted during lucid periods.

He is preceded in death by his wife Magdalena (2023), his parents and most of his siblings. He is survived by his children Maria (Daniel Pimentel) of Malin, OR, Joel (Delia) Lemus of Seattle, WA, Magdalena Jaquelina Lemus of Seattle, WA, Eliseo (Maria de los Angeles) Lemus of Salem, OR and Isai (Janeth) Lemus of Seattle. Grandchildren, Daniela (Daniel Brick) Pimentel, Laura Lemus, Joel David Lemus, Cassandra Lemus-Sodji, Paulina Lemus, Gabriel Lemus, Rafael Lemus and Sofia Lemus.
